Description

First, note that the scenario described in this wish involves the Watchlist preference "Expand watchlist to show all changes, not just the most recent" not being checked.

See phab:T11790 - created in 2007, and followed up by a wish in 2016 that was well received.

Copied from the ticket:

As a patroller, I want to hide certain edits from my Watchlist, while still being able to see any previous edits which occurred, so that I can better monitor changes on my project.On Special:Watchlist, by default users only see the most recent edit to pages they have watched. Sometimes, however, they don't want to see edits by certain kinds of users, such as bots, or edits marked as 'minor'. Currently, if users filter their Watchlist to remove certain edits, if a page has that kind of edit as its most recent, it simply does not display in their Watchlist at all, instead of displaying the most recent non-filtered edit. This is undesirable, because edits can easily be missed if a subsequent edit is filtered out by a user's configured preferences. A vandal could, for example, vandalise a page, and then make a subsequent minor edit, and users who filter out minor edits would not see their vandalism edit. In fact they wouldn't see that any edit had been made to that page at all - it simply wouldn't display in their watchlist.

As far as I know, this issue persists and needs addressing at long last.
